PTFE (Polytetrafluoroethylene) stands out for its exceptional chemical resistance, electrical insulating properties, and thermal stability, unmatched by other plastics. With an operating range from -200 °C to +260 °C, PTFE is suitable for both extreme cold and high temperatures. Its semi-crystalline, rubber-like soft structure makes it flexible and durable – ideal for seals, sliding bearings, sealing profiles, and numerous industrial applications.

The properties of PTFE can be specifically tailored by compounding with fillers:

  • Wear resistance: Increases by 200 to 1000 times compared to pure PTFE.
  • Compressive strength and thermal conductivity: Can be optimized depending on the application requirements.
  • Anti-adhesive behavior: Mostly retained, though slightly reduced at high filler content.
  • Chemical resistance: Depends on the type of filler used.
  • Coloring: Special pigments allow coloring for identification or specific applications.
  • Physiological behavior:

    • PTFE is physiologically stable at room temperature and is almost non-flammable.
    • Material properties are not affected by contact with aggressive media.
    • Vapors are only released above +360 °C, which can be relevant for health.
  • Sliding behavior:

    • Very low coefficient of friction – identical behavior under static and dynamic friction.
    • Transition from rest to motion occurs smoothly.
    • No stick-slip effect due to extremely low intermolecular forces.
  • Wear behavior:

    • Pure white PTFE is only surpassed in abrasion resistance by a few materials.
    • Particles sinter together during processing, so no true melt occurs.
    • Behavior can be specifically tailored with fillers depending on the application.
